Statement

Given two strings, order and s, where all characters in order are unique and arranged in a custom order, return any permutation of s that satisfies the following condition:

The characters in the permuted s should appear in the same relative order as they do in order. Specifically, if a character x appears before a character y in order, then x must also appear before y in the permuted string.
